Bathinda, March 24
The Education Department has decided to observe the World No Tobacco Day on May 15.The Director General of School Education(DGSE) has given school heads and teachers the responsibility of making students aware of the ill effects of consuming tobacco and tobacco based products.
In a communique sent to the school heads, the DGSE has directed the schools to organise special programmes from May 1 to May 15 to ensure that students know about the affects of tobacco products.
As part of the fortnightly events, the schools may organise athletics competitions, essay writing, slogan writing and poster making competitions for students of secondary and higher secondary classes. The competitions aim at motivating the students to follow a healthy lifestyle and say no to any kind of habit forming substance.
During special morning assembly in schools, the students will be told about the problem of drug addiction.
